pow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Не отрабатывает в скрипте команда ALTER TABLE
3 сообщений из 3, страница 1 из 1
Не отрабатывает в скрипте команда ALTER TABLE
    #33961034
OlegA67
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Добрый день. Возникли трудности с командой ALTER TABLE следующего типа

DB2 ALTER TABLE PENS.EDV ADD CONSTRAINT CC1153980741828 CHECK (SEX IN ('М','Ж') AND (DIST = 17) AND (SNILS > 999999) AND (VID_SPK1 IN (1,2)) AND (VID_SPK2 IN (1,2))) ENFORCED ENABLE QUERY OPTIMIZATION

причем эта же команда из Command Line Processor отрабатывает нормально. Выяснил, что из Сommand Window эта строка не отрабатывает из-за конструкции SNILS > 999999, а вернее из-за знака >. если его поменять на знак равно =, то все прекрасно будет работать. Пришлось конструкцию (SNILS > 999999) менять на (SNILS BETWEEN 1000000 AND 999999999). Но хотелось понять причину из-за чего не проходит команда со знаком >. Хотя есть предположение что скрипт этот знак принимает за перенаправления вывода, если так и есть на самом деле, то как это обойти. Буду признателен за совет
...
Рейтинг: 0 / 0
Не отрабатывает в скрипте команда ALTER TABLE
    #33961254
mxk
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
mxk
Гость
db2 "select ... > ... "
...
Рейтинг: 0 / 0
Не отрабатывает в скрипте команда ALTER TABLE
    #33961534
OlegA67
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
с кавычками все пошло нормально, спасибо
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Не отрабатывает в скрипте команда ALTER TABLE
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]